Transaction 18881d14b2f052909bb3c19b8539aa933ed0b2e8e5058f78ffa5220efa25ffe1
1 Input
1 Output
-
18881d14b2f052909bb3c19b8539aa933ed0b2e8e5058f78ffa5220efa25ffe1:0
- value
- 19665326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da419b4e940fd8b840f29dc3de6d67a8f9169f32 OP_EQUAL
- address
- 3Mb3po1Bu1GDX6gzZ22gDnu62P4hQkxodn